18-22 Ashwin Street
E8 3DL

View Larger Map

Central Africa's Rights and Aids (CARA) Society

CARA (Central Africa's Rights and Aids Society) is an independent charity that was set up in July 2003 to provide free legal advice and respresentation to people facing disadvantage. It is an international organisation committed and dedicated to empowering the poor by promoting justice,  health,  Education and social development of all its members and the public by improving the quality of life of the disadvantaged people of our community through helping them to know,  understand and achieve their rights. We rely on our members and the generosity of the public in securing donations and legacies so that we can continue the work we provide.